From Chaos to Opportunity, and Reflections by Leonard Cohen

Chaos is a time of upheaval and confusion… not exactly a fun state of mind for the individual or society.  The reality of the Buddha’s profound teaching on impermanence is brought clearly into view when the ground we stand on is no longer stable.   Yet this is also a time which offers a unique opportunity to mindfully adjust how we think, act and speak due to our suddenly shifted reality.  Leonard Cohen, Canadian poet and song-writer who died November 7, 2016, delved into the chaos of his own life as well as society, through his unique artistic expression. His genius was ultimately embracing it all.  On Thursday we will discuss chaos and  opportunity along with some reflections by Leonard Cohen.

Family Sangha
Next Meeting: Sunday, December 11 at the Sacramento Dharma Center

Family Sangha welcomes those who want to develop dharma practice in a family setting -- parents, grandparents, uncles, aunts, and more.

We offer indoor and outdoor activities for kids up to 12 years, expressing values of the Buddha way - compassion, curiosity, generosity, kindness, and mindfulness. Adults have time for meditation, play, and discussion. Please bring snacks, clothes suitable for outdoor play, and remain on the premises for the entire session if you bring children.
